Question:

Which of the following can NOT be considered as an element of directing?

Options:

Coordination

Motivation

Communication

Supervision

Correct Answer:

Coordination

Explanation:

The correct answer is option 1- Coordination.

Coordination is not an element of directing.

The process by which a manager synchronises the activities of different departments is known as coordination. Coordination is the force that binds all the other functions of management. It is the common thread that runs through all activities such as purchase, production, sales, and finance to ensure continuity in the working of the organisation. 

 

Directing may broadly be grouped into four categories which are the elements of directing. These are: (i) Supervision (ii) Motivation (iii) Leadership (iv) Communication.

  • Motivation means incitement or inducement to act or move. In the context of an organisation, it means the process of making subordinates to act in a desired manner to achieve certain organisational goals. Motivation is a complex process as individuals are heterogeneous in their expectations, perceptions and reactions.
  • Supervision can be understood as the process of guiding the efforts of employees and other resources to accomplish the desired objectives. It is an element of direction. It can be understood as a process as well as the functions performed by supervisor (a position at operative level).
  • Communication is a process by which people create and share information with one another in order to reach common understanding.
